在如今这个互联网高速发展的时代,拥有一个属于自己的专业网站已成为越来越多人和企业的需求。无论是个人博客,还是企业官网,网站都是展示自己形象、吸引客户的重要窗口。为了帮助大家更好地完成这一目标,本文将为你提供一份详细的“网站源码搭建教程”,让你能从零基础开始,轻松搭建一个功能丰富、外观精美的网站。
1.为什么要学习网站源码搭建?
虽然市面上有很多现成的建站工具和模板可以供我们使用,但如果你希望拥有一个独特且完全符合自己需求的网站,或者你想深入理解网站的构建过程,学习网站源码搭建将是一个非常有价值的技能。通过掌握源码搭建,你将获得以下几个优势:
个性化定制:通过源码修改,你可以自由定制网站的各项功能和页面布局,做到完全符合你的需求。
控制权:拥有网站源码,你将不再依赖第三方平台,完全掌控自己网站的运营和数据。
提升技术能力:学习源码搭建能够帮助你深入理解前端开发、后端开发等相关技术,为今后的职业发展打下坚实基础。
2.网站搭建前的准备工作
在开始搭建网站之前,我们需要做一些基础的准备工作。你需要确定网站的目标和功能。问问自己:这个网站是个人博客、企业官网还是在线商店?选择合适的技术栈和开发工具也非常重要。以下是一些常见的开发工具和语言:
HTML/CSS:作为网站的基础构建块,HTML负责网页的结构,CSS负责网页的样式。
JavaScript:增加网页的互动功能,提升用户体验。
PHP/MySQL:如果你需要后台功能(例如用户注册、数据存储等),那么学习PHP和MySQL是非常必要的。
代码编辑器:例如VSCode,SublimeText等,能够帮助你更加高效地编写代码。
3.开始搭建你的网站
第一步:搭建网站的基本结构
网站的基本结构通常由头部(Header)、主体(Body)和尾部(Footer)组成。我们可以先通过HTML语言来建立这些结构。下面是一个简单的网页结构示例:
我的网站
欢迎来到我的网站
首页内容
这里是我的网站首页内容。
©2025我的公司|版权所有
在上面的代码中,我们已经创建了一个简单的网页结构,包含了网页的头部、主体内容和尾部部分。我们可以使用CSS来美化这些内容,使其更加吸引人。
第二步:为网站添加样式
CSS是用来控制网站的外观和布局的,使用CSS可以让你的网站看起来更美观、现代。以下是一个简单的CSS样式示例:
/*style.css*/
body{
font-family:Arial,sans-serif;
background-color:#f4f4f4;
margin:0;
padding:0;
}
header{
background-color:#333;
color:white;
padding:10px0;
text-align:center;
}
navul{
list-style:none;
padding:0;
}
navulli{
display:inline;
margin-right:20px;
}
navullia{
color:white;
text-decoration:none;
}
footer{
background-color:#333;
color:white;
text-align:center;
padding:10px0;
position:fixed;
width:100%;
bottom:0;
}
这个CSS样式为网页添加了背景颜色、字体样式、导航菜单的布局等元素,使得网站的外观更加简洁和专业。
4.优化与测试
在你完成了基础的网页搭建和样式设计之后,接下来就是测试和优化的阶段。测试包括但不限于:
不同设备的适配:确保网站在手机、平板、PC等不同设备上都能正常显示。
页面加载速度优化:压缩图片和代码,减少不必要的请求,提高页面加载速度。
通过这些准备工作,你的第一个基础网站已经搭建完成。在接下来的部分,我们将继续探讨如何添加更多的互动功能和后台支持,帮助你打造一个更加专业的网站。
在上一部分中,我们为大家介绍了网站搭建的基本步骤,搭建了一个简单的网站框架,并通过CSS对网站进行了样式美化。要打造一个功能完整、用户友好的网站,还需要添加更多的功能和优化。我们将介绍如何通过JavaScript实现交互功能、如何使用PHP进行网站后台搭建以及如何进行网站的发布。
1.添加交互功能
JavaScript是实现网页交互功能的关键语言。通过JavaScript,你可以让网站拥有动态效果,例如图片轮播、表单验证、弹出窗口等。以下是一个简单的JavaScript示例,展示了如何实现一个按钮点击后的弹窗效果:
点击我
</h3><p>document.getElementById("showMessageButton").onclick=function(){</p><h3>alert("你好,欢迎来到我的网站!");</h3><h3>}</h3><h3>
这个简单的代码段通过JavaScript实现了点击按钮时弹出提示框的效果。通过类似的方法,你可以为你的网站添加更多的互动功能,提升用户体验。
2.使用PHP与MySQL实现后台功能
如果你的网站需要用户注册、登录、留言板等功能,那么你需要使用后端技术来处理用户请求并与数据库进行交互。PHP是一种常见的后台开发语言,MySQL则是常用的数据库管理系统。以下是一个简单的PHP示例,展示了如何连接数据库并执行查询:
//连接到数据库
$conn=newmysqli("localhost","root","","mydatabase");
//检查连接是否成功
if($conn->connect_error){
die("连接失败:".$conn->connect_error);
}
//执行SQL查询
$sql="SELECT*FROMusers";
$result=$conn->query($sql);
if($result->num_rows>0){
while($row=$result->fetch_assoc()){
echo"用户名:".$row["username"]."";
}
}else{
echo"没有找到用户";
}
$conn->close();
?>
这个示例展示了如何通过PHP连接到MySQL数据库,并查询用户表中的数据。在实际的项目中,你可以根据自己的需求进行更复杂的数据库操作,支持用户注册、留言等功能。
3.网站发布与优化
完成网站开发后,最后一步就是将其发布到互联网上。你需要购买域名和主机,选择合适的服务器进行托管。常见的服务器有阿里云、腾讯云等。购买并配置好服务器后,将网站源码上传到服务器,并确保服务器正常运行。
在网站发布后,网站的优化也是非常重要的。你需要进行SEO优化,提高网站在搜索引擎中的排名,吸引更多的访问者。定期更新网站内容、添加新的功能也是保持网站活力和吸引力的关键。
4.总结
通过本教程的学习,你应该已经掌握了如何从零开始搭建一个简单的独立网站。从基础的HTML/CSS页面结构,到交互的JavaScript功能,再到后台PHP和数据库的使用,每一步都为你打造一个专业网站打下了坚实的基础。掌握这些技能后,你将能够根据自己的需求,定制和管理一个独特的网站,提升个人或企业的在线形象。
希望这篇教程能够帮助你实现建站梦想,开始你的网站搭建之旅!